The short version

The System is a place to play, create, and share interactive stories. Treat other players and creators with respect, label your content honestly, and don't use the platform to create or share anything illegal or harmful. These guidelines sit alongside the Terms of Service — breaking them can lead to content removal or account suspension.

Content that is never allowed

Some content is prohibited everywhere on the platform, in every mode, regardless of a world's rating:

• Any sexual content involving minors, or content that sexualizes minors — including fictional, AI-generated, or “aged-up” depictions. This is a zero-tolerance rule and confirmed cases are reported to the relevant authorities.
• Real-world threats, incitement of violence, or content that promotes terrorism or mass harm.
• Harassment, hate, or dehumanizing content targeting people based on who they are.
• Non-consensual intimate content, doxxing, or sharing another person's private information.
• Content that facilitates real-world illegal activity.

Mature content and world ratings

Worlds are rated all-ages or mature. Mature worlds may contain adult themes and are available only to signed-in adults (18+). Rate your worlds honestly: do not label mature content as all-ages, and do not attempt to bypass age or access gates. Mislabeling content to reach a wider audience is a guidelines violation.

AI-generated content is your responsibility

Narration, character portraits, and world art are AI-generated from the prompts, worlds, and choices you provide. You are responsible for what you prompt and for what you publish. Review AI outputs before sharing or publishing them, and do not use prompts intended to produce prohibited content or to defeat safety systems.

Creating and publishing worlds

A published world can be played by other people, so it must match its stated rating and content. Only publish worlds you have the rights to share. Don't publish spam, scams, impersonation, or worlds whose real purpose is to route players toward prohibited content.

Reporting and enforcement

If you see content that breaks these guidelines, use the in-product report option. Reports go to a moderation queue for human review. We may hide, remove, or restrict content and warn, suspend, or terminate accounts depending on the severity and pattern of violations. We aim to be proportionate, and serious or repeated violations are treated more seriously than one-off mistakes.

Appeals and account integrity

If you believe an enforcement action was a mistake, you can appeal it through the appeals flow. Do not evade enforcement by creating replacement accounts. Each account is the responsibility of one person, and abuse of the platform's systems — including automated scraping or attempts to overwhelm shared resources — is not permitted.
